? h n THE NEW YORK BOTANICAL GARDEN INSTITUTO NACIONAL DE PESQUISAS DA AMAZONIA Plants of Brazilian Amazonia Territory of Roraima No- 20085 Yle.u^xa'tu-s Auaris Mission, Rio Auaris; alt. 2600 ft. Growing on dead log. White on both surfaces. Boiled and eaten by Sanama Indians; has a hot, peppery, burning taste.
